🚧 Traffic Update – Park Road, Killarney

⛔ A Stop & Go traffic management system will be in place on Park Road this Tuesday & Wednesday (from 7:00 a.m.) to facilitate works on the Park Road Active Travel Scheme.

Some delays are expected — motorists are advised to use Countess Road as an alternative route.

⚠️ Yellow Rainfall Warning for Kerry ⚠️
Heavy rain is expected from 17:00 Saturday 18th October until 05:00 Sunday 19th October.

🌧️ Potential Impacts:
• Localised flooding
• Difficult travelling conditions

Please take extra care on the roads and stay updated on local weather reports.

Today I learned:

That #kestrels are on the red list of most concern for conservation of birds in #Ireland due to persistent annual decline, apparently due to a combination of farming practices, #raptor #persecution, and #rural #urbanisation, which takes away not only their foraging areas, but their prey, and habitat suitability.

Now, what do we have here perched on an ESB electricity wire scouting for prey behind our garden, and on land for which a proposed dwelling has been applied for by 3rd parties? This is literally a few metres from a "special area of conservation".

Pictures taken in August 2023 and again in August 2025.

[16:03] Map of dog attacks in Kerry cannot be published due to GDPR ‘nonsense’

A map of dog attack incidents developed by Kerry County Council in the past 12 months cannot be published or circulated because of data protection concerns.
